Dr Anusha Raveendran is a GP (General Practitioner) based in Beecroft, NSW. Her degree and years of experience are not specified in the profile, but she works at Beecroft Medical Centre, located at Shop 2, 97-99 Beecroft Road, Beecroft NSW 2119. This makes her part of the local Australian healthcare scene where residents can access general medical care close to home. 
 
 Dr Raveendran offers a range of common primary care services. Patients can book for annual check-ups to keep an eye on health and prevent problems. She also provides prescription refills, cold and flu treatment, blood pressure monitoring, and minor wound care.
